Problem Statement
Using current and historical data from DeFi to warn MetaMask users before making a transfer to a known-malicious address. Information is stored in a smart contract on web3 and accessed using the Pocket network to further decentralise the approach. Added information is available on IPFS to reduce the cost of the service. Users are notified when trying to make a transaction about the validity of a contract address based on a variety of factors explained in the next section.
Solution
Building on the MetaMask source code we have deployed a plug-in (snap) which intercepts the recipient address whilst a user is going through the motions of sending funds.The address is then verified using a variety of sources, including:Etherscan apiCryptoscamdb apiData scraped from social media (twitter posts and youtube videos offering 2-4-1 on deposits)Static analysis of contract codeBytecode pattern matching of smart contractsUser feedbackData stored on the IPFS which can provide more information besides a simple score.
